Appgate SDP and ThreatLocker Zero Trust Endpoint Protection Platform are both competitors in the cybersecurity space focusing on network and endpoint protection. Appgate SDP holds an advantage in network segmentation and dynamic access control, while ThreatLocker excels in application and endpoint lockdown, offering extensive protection features.
Features: Appgate SDP offers strong identity-centric and context-aware access control that ensures fine-grained network segmentation and dynamic access control. ThreatLocker provides comprehensive application whitelisting, ringfencing, and vast lock-down capabilities, reducing unauthorized access risks.
Room for Improvement: Appgate SDP could enhance its ease of deployment and streamline the setup process. Improving user accessibility can also provide better support. ThreatLocker may enhance endpoint granularity and refine its learning mode to decrease initial setup complexity. Enhancing application approval processes can further help reduce impactful wait times.
Ease of Deployment and Customer Service: ThreatLocker features a swift deployment process supported by comprehensive documentation and immediate customer assistance, which can shorten deployment timelines. Appgate SDP, while robust in network configurations, has a more sophisticated setup process, offering longstanding expertise in troubleshooting.
Pricing and ROI: Appgate SDP has a higher price point, reflecting advanced security features, potentially offering significant ROI for large enterprises. ThreatLocker, with a cost-efficient pricing model, appeals to smaller businesses, offering quick ROI and efficient endpoint protection without substantial initial costs.

Appgate SDP is a network access control tool for local and remote access, multifactor authentication, and micro-segmentation. It is a flexible, robust, and configurable tool with good documentation, interface improvements, and ease of deployment.
It helps organizations prevent lateral movement across networks and servers and provides a more granular access control structure than traditional VPNs. Appgate SDP's valuable features include the ability to hide servers, good support, stability, scalability, and stopping lateral movement. It is currently being used as the main VPN solution for many companies.
ThreatLocker Zero Trust Endpoint Protection Platform offers robust endpoint security through application control and allowlisting, safeguarding servers and workstations from unauthorized software execution.
ThreatLocker Zero Trust Endpoint Protection Platform provides extensive application control with features like ring-fencing and selective elevation, ensuring meticulous execution management. Offering learning mode and extensive support, it integrates threat detection and activity monitoring to enhance compliance, reduce costs, and bolster cybersecurity through alerts and approvals. Despite its strengths, there are areas for improvement in training flexibility, policy updates, and interface enhancements, along with challenges in handling non-digitally signed software. Deployed across environments, it works well with existing cybersecurity instruments for real-time threat prevention.
